If I understand my genetics correctly, every chick he sires should turn out blue. Splash birds are homozygous for the blue gene, and blue birds are heterozygous. Every bird he sires with a non-blue bird will be heterozygous, thus blue. If he is bred to a blue bird, half of his offspring will...
